    Description: My GG grandpa "Paschal" C. Grammier.

    My aunt, Marie (his G grand-daughter), and I were discussing Paschal the other day.

    Aunt Marie, said her mother-- Agnes Marie Grammier -- told her the story of PASCHAL going to work in Galveston,Tx.

    And on September 8, 1900 "The Hurricane of 1900" which is the worst disater in American History occurred, and PASCHAL was never seen or heard from again.

    My Grand-Mother {Agnes}, also told the story to us, when she lived with us, before her demise how the family was devastated, and (grandma, being abt. 8 yrs. old) had to move in with her GRAND-MOTHER -- "Paschal's wife" to help care for her.

    About 6,000 people perished in that Hurricane, and probably other families have no "DEATH RECORD" for their loved ones. I hope if you run across any Galveston Indexes of the victims you can help us get closure.
